A fantastic opportunity has arisen for a chartered town planner at Principal or Associate level to join one of the leading planning teams in Bristol. You will be joining a key name in the industry boasting a very well-established team working on some of the most exciting projects in the city. You will be based in the centre of Bristol and working in a busy, modern and open plan office.

We are looking for candidates who are MRTPI qualified and have substantial private sector experience, ideally gained in the Bristol market (we may consider relocators for candidates who have similar city centre regeneration experience in a consultancy environment). We can consider a strong senior planner for the right person or more likely an existing principal/associate/associate director. The team work on a range of projects including city centre regeneration schemes, commercial developments, sport/leisure, retail/mixed-use and residential projects. They also have clients in the public sector so can offer a varied and exciting portfolio of work with many of the city's high profile schemes. Your role will include; site visits, site appraisals, feasibility studies, writing planning statements, preparing and submitting planning applications, S106 negotiations, project managing large, complex developments, mentoring junior staff, liaising with professional bodies and specialist consultants, appeals, business development and providing the high level of expert town planning advice and consultancy service expected from this team.

We are looking for candidates who have good experience of managing complex projects with a proven track record of fee earning and building/retaining a good client base. You should be able to cope with a fast-paced environment and varied portfolio. You should be confident in client facing situations and in your presentation skills, you should enjoy networking and a busy team environment.
